Bereavement Risk Assessment Scale (BRAT)
The Bereavement Risk Assessment Tool, or BRAT, is a psychosocial assessment tool used by care teams to communicate personal, interpersonal and situational factors that may place a caregiver or family member at greater risk for a significantly negative bereavement experience.
